Brought my Puppycat Simba in in an emergency. They kept him overnight on an IV, and flushed what we're guessing was a stray Tylenol poisoning. Lucky boy. He couldn't walk when I brought him in. Th... Read More
Brought my Puppycat Simba in in an emergency. They kept him overnight on an IV, and flushed what we're guessing was a stray Tylenol poisoning. Lucky boy. He couldn't walk when I brought him in. They charged half when I left him, and the balance when I picked him up. ALL VET SERVICES ARW EXPENSIVE, AND THIS 25 HOURS COST $650. WELL WORTH EVERY PENNY FOR MH RUSSIAN BLUE PRINCE. Read Less
